Key Fobs that are lost or stolen

Modern car keys are convenient, capable, and more secure than ever--but the convenience comes at cost: If you lose your keys, you'll likely have to contact an auto locksmith to get an extra one programmed. The exact cost for this service will vary based on the year, make, and model of your vehicle.

You could be able to program a replacement fob yourself depending on the model and brand of your vehicle. A lot of automakers provide instructions on how to do this in their owner's manuals, and you can also find the information on the internet. The problem is that these procedures are often time-consuming and frustrating, which is why the majority of people prefer calling a locksmith for assistance.

If you have keys that were either stolen or lost or stolen, you may be able to get it replaced by your local auto dealer. It is important to note that you will have to pay an auto dealer for key programming, which can be costly.

Misplaced Car Keys

The size of car keys make them easy to lose. They can fit in almost every purse or pocket. In reality, it's believed that the average person loses their car keys at least once a year.1 This is why it is crucial for drivers to always keep an extra key in the event of an emergency.

Unlike older, non-transponder keys that were used in the past, modern vehicles employ transponder chips in their keys, which communicate with the computer in your vehicle to allow you to unlock or start the engine. Fortunately, the majority keys can be replaced and programmed at a locksmith or key programmer near you. You can find the right firm by searching on the internet for 'car key programmer near me'.

The process of programming a brand new key is usually simple, but every manufacturer and each car may be slightly different. In the owner's guide of your vehicle, you will generally find detailed instructions. In most cases, you'll need to insert the key and turn it off and on multiple times to program it correctly.

You'll need to visit a dealer to program keys for the newest cars. Some manufacturers use a system that ensures that only their dealers are able to create new keys. Locksmiths cannot copy them.
